Exploring Head Water Pumps for Optimal Water Transfer

Head water pumps are indispensable in a myriad of sectors, enabling the transfer of water from its origin to the intended destination. These pumps are engineered to surmount the challenges posed by friction and gravity in piping systems, guaranteeing a steady and sufficient flow for diverse uses. Their applications span from agricultural irrigation and residential water systems to water distribution networks and industrial contexts where the efficient movement of substantial water volumes is crucial.

At the heart of head water pumps lies the principle of centrifugal force. Within the pump, a spinning impeller imparts velocity to the water, generating a centrifugal force that propels the liquid through the system. This mechanism ensures a persistent water flow, vital for the smooth functioning of industrial machinery and the watering of crops in agricultural ventures. Head water pumps are available in a variety of designs and sizes, tailored to meet the specific requirements of the volume and distance of water transport.

These units are not solely for industry professionals but also cater to individuals needing to transfer water for personal use, such as in residential settings or small-scale farming. Their efficiency, dependability, and adaptability render them an essential component in numerous operations where water movement is fundamental. With correct installation and upkeep, head water pumps can offer enduring and reliable performance.

Diverse Head Water Pump Varieties for Effective Water Transfer

Head water pumps are available in an array of configurations to accommodate different applications across both high and low-pressure environments:

  • Centrifugal Pumps: The most prevalent variety, these pumps employ an impeller to channel water from the inlet to the outlet, augmenting the water's momentum with centrifugal force. They prove effective in settings ranging from agricultural irrigation to domestic use.

  • Reciprocating Pumps: In contrast to centrifugal pumps, reciprocating pumps utilize a piston within a cylinder to move water. They are particularly suited to scenarios requiring high pressure or where water demand varies, often found in industrial utilities or homes with inadequate water pressure.

  • Submersible Pumps: Tailored for submerged operations such as well extraction or underwater pressure enhancement, these pumps operate while immersed in the fluid they pump. They excel at drawing water from deep subterranean sources to the surface.

  • Screw Pumps: As positive-displacement pumps, they transport fluid in a continuous motion akin to a nut's progression along a bolt. Noted for their dependability, they are frequently employed in sewage systems and wastewater treatment facilities.

  • Lobe Pumps: Also referred to as rotary lobe pumps, these devices utilize multiple lobes in a chamber to convey fluids. Their gentle pumping action makes them ideal for transporting viscous or sensitive fluids without causing shear.

Each pump type boasts distinct characteristics and typical applications, underscoring the importance of matching the pump to the specific demands of its intended use.

Frequently Asked Questions on Head Water Pumps for Efficient Water Movement

What is the expected lifespan of a head water pump?

The longevity of a head water pump varies with its model, frequency of use, and maintenance regimen. Typically, well-maintained, high-caliber pumps endure for many years, though industrial pumps may require more frequent replacement.

How can I ascertain the correct size of head water pump for my needs?

Account for the flow rate and pressure demands of your specific application. Opt for a pump that can manage the anticipated volume and deliver adequate pressure for your operations.

Are head water pumps capable of handling both clean and contaminated water?

Certain head water pump models are engineered to process clean water, while others are equipped to manage minor solid content for applications involving some contamination.

Which features are advisable in a head water pump for industrial applications?

Industrial applications benefit from pumps with high-pressure capabilities, resilience for continuous usage, and energy-efficient motors when relevant.

Do head water pumps exist that are suitable for outdoor or agricultural purposes?

Indeed, submersible pumps designed for outdoor or agricultural applications can accommodate various water types, including those containing solids and debris.

What maintenance is required for head water pumps?

Head water pumps necessitate routine checks for leaks, cleanliness from debris and corrosion, and inspections of the motor and seals for signs of wear or damage.

How do single-stage pumps differ from multi-stage pumps?

A single-stage pump features one impeller and is typically used for low-pressure tasks, whereas a multi-stage pump has multiple impellers, enabling it to generate higher pressure for more demanding industrial or municipal applications.

What materials are commonly used to manufacture head water pumps?

Head water pumps are constructed from various materials, such as stainless steel, cast iron, and occasionally other metals like bronze, to meet the specific durability and corrosion resistance needs of different applications.
